If you trust someone with the information, share it with them privately off-site. It's not strictly or explicitly against any rules, because it's just another user purchasing the card in their currency, and the exchange rates being favorable to allow you to re-purchase it at a lower cost than if you bought direct, but drawing TNT's attention to this issue isn't recommended. While I doubt it's high up on their radar I would not put it past them to put some sort of punishing measure in effect that limits redemption of cards purchased in other countries, or dreams up some other alternative "solution" to make it more "fair."
I appreciate and treasure the users purchasing these cards in their local currencies and supplying them to us at a lower cost. While I enjoy getting NC at a more reasonable rate, more importantly I would never want to risk being a party to anything adverse - even the minimal profit they make flipping these cards - happening to these awesome people just to publicize this information. However to shine some light on cheaper cards, TnT is unable to stop them unless they bring up all old/unused codes and region locked them; much like steam and other bigger games and companies do. Region locking means splitting them up like North America, China, ect and having players unable to redeem codes they purchased from someone in another region. Some sites counter things like this only accepting usd and not having cards in shops. But without it being region locked TnT really can't yell at you for having a card from somewhere else. they themselves can't prove you didn't buy the code while away somewhere or someone bought it for you as a gift. If they started doing this and giving users trouble they may have to stop letting other websites have the codes as well since people can still grab restocking codes from them.
And like, they can try to stop users from selling it but people always will. They can't prove you bought it from a person vs a shop. they can get upset at the sellers but just like black market anything it won't stop them.
TLDR; it's not against the rules, if it was they could have a bigger mess on their hands than they really want to mess with.
